Fortnite: The Game with the Most Playtime

Fortnite tops the list of games with the most playtime, boasting an astonishing 96 billion hours of total gametime since its launch. Yes, you read that right – 96 billion hours! This is equivalent to roughly 4 billion days of total gameplay. With its addictive gameplay, stunning visuals, and constant updates, it’s no surprise that Fortnite has become the go-to game for gamers of all ages.

Here’s a breakdown of the top 5 games with the most playtime:

Rank Game Playtime (Hours) Gametime (Days)
1 Fortnite 96 billion 4 billion
2 World of Warcraft 67.2 billion 2.8 billion
3 League of Legends 23.5 billion 1.2 billion
4 Minecraft 17.1 billion 745 million
5 PlayerUnknown’s Battlegrounds 13.6 billion 594 million

What’s Behind Fortnite’s Phenomenal Success?

Fortnite’s success can be attributed to several factors, including:

  • Regular Updates: Fortnite’s constant updates with new content, seasons, and events keep players engaged and excited about the game.
  • Cross-Platform Play: Fortnite allows players to play together across different platforms, making it easy for friends to join and play together.
  • Accessible Gameplay: Fortnite’s easy-to-learn gameplay mechanics and accessible controls make it easy for new players to pick up and play.
  • Social Aspect: Fortnite’s social features, such as the ability to spectate and watch other players, foster a sense of community and social interaction among players.
